Well when you get the Nashorn for half the price of a JP. And mounts same gun as the JP you can't expect it to have good armor aswell.

Like i said Nashorns are not for soaking damage in any way. Just shoot and then hide.

I dont recomend you try to fight Pershings and IS-2s at max range with it. Cuz then it will normaly deflect or miss.
However many times you can just quickly race for the enemy tank while its bussy. I Normaly get close enough so i get roughly 130-150 in penetration(which can be done from pretty far away). Then the chances of a kill is more like 70% if you manges to get your shot off.

Now ofc the Nashorn can get spotted and fucked up, or it misses. But you can't really expect it to be 100% sucessfull when its fighting units twice its cost.

Also don't recomend using Nashorns vs IS-3s. Even King tigers have to be damn close to kill and IS-3 frontally. And you will never be able to get that close with a Nashorns paperthin armor.

But yeah, if you can afford a JP. Its normaly a safer investment.
But don't underestimate the Nashorn. have killed many IS-2s, Pershings, IS-1s etc with it.

Nashorns is a very good unit, if you use it correctly. Move it up towards the front and it is a dead duck in no time... when used from ambush and from the rear, and having infantry doing the scouting, it can deliver death to the enemy quite easy. Just remember to only shot one or two rounds from the same position and NEVER let it use "fire at will", the Nashorn is a unit that should only be used with direct control (since otherwise you can be pretty sure that it will reveal its position by firing a HE shell against a lone enemy infantry guy...).
